Stuffed Chicken Roast
Stuffed Chicken Roast is delicious and fulfilling recipe usually prepared for a special occasions or family celebrations.
Servings: 4
Ingredients
- 2 boneless chicken legs
- 200 ml milk
- 2 pieces of bread or small baguette
- 1 egg
- 50 g onions
- 1 small onion finely chopped
- 5 g bacon nicely cut
- 2 tbsp fresh parsley
- 1 tsp marjoram fresh is prefferable
- salt and black pepper to taste
- vegetable oil
- 1 tbsp butter
Instructions
- In a bowl crush the bread into small pieces and pour the milk and wet it well.
- Heat up a skillet over medium heat and add onions with bacon. Fry them with little butter until the onion gets translucent then season with marjoram and parsley.
- Turn off the heat add the wet bread and let it cool for a few minutes. Then add the egg.
- Prepare the meat and season with salt and pepper then put filling on the meat and roll it around.
- heat in a frying pan at high temperature.
- Season with salt, pepper, and marjoram then transfer them to the pan and fry from all sides quickly.
- Preheat the oven to 130° C.
- Transfer to a baking tray, add a little bit onion, wine and the rest of the butter, then cover with aluminum foil.
- Place the baking dish in the oven and roast for about 50 minutes.
- Let it cool then cut in slices and serve with a wine.
